The desire to appear sylph-like demanded the creation of Pointe technique and the Pointe shoe.  Extensive training and practice are required to develop the strength, technique and artistry needed to dance en pointe.

Adults Pointe workshop classes at Melbourne Institute of Dance are delivered as a structured course for classical dancers with a solid foundation in their technique.
Â
A minimum Level 3 standard of adult ballet is required. As well as being cleared from a physiotherapist's pre-pointe assessment. (Please contact us for more information regarding pre-pointe assessments by recommended physiotherapists)
Â
These term-long courses will teach
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Essential foot care and strengthening techniques
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Pointe shoe understanding
-Â Â Â Â Warm-up techniques
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Barre work and centre work (where safe and possible)
Each class will develop and progress from the one prior, so attending all classes is requested.
Â
Class structure
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Student are to be ballet ready and warmed up prior to attending these classes, It is suggested that you attend the Adults Level 2 class prior. Â
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Pointe specific warm up (approximately 15mins)
-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Pointe work and related activities (approximately 45min)
